CIO: Growth in Software-Defined Storage Drives DataCore Expansion in Australia

From: http://www.cio.com.au/25219/growth-in-software-defined-storage-drives/ 

DataCore, a leader in Software-Defined Storage and hyper-converged virtual SAN solutions, today announced an increase in sales and further expansion of their Australian operations to support the recent and rapid business demand for DataCore solutions within ANZ.

DataCore storage virtualization and hyper-converged virtual SAN solutions empower organisations to seamlessly manage, protect and scale their data storage. These technologies enhance and work with the data storage products already in use within most organisations, and are able to deliver massive performance gains, higher availability and new levels of flexibility at a fraction of the cost of solutions offered by legacy storage hardware vendors.

Marco Marinelli has been added to the team and has been appointed as a Regional Sales Director for Australia and New Zealand, based in DataCore’s Melbourne office. Marco has 30 years of technology industry experience, with recent senior positions at Dell and HP.

Australia is now the headquarters for DataCore’s expansion into the Asia Pacific Region, with Jamie Humphrey recently announced as VP of Asia Pacific and Japan Sales in May 2015, and Orla Hanby appointed as Marketing Manager. This expansion has coincided with an expansion of DataCore’s partner program, to support increased end user demand for software defined storage solutions.

Mr. Humphrey commented, “With more than 1,000 customer sites already up and running within the Asia Pacific region, we are continuing to rapidly grow our presence within Australia and New Zealand, with offices in Sydney and Melbourne.”

Technology alliances with Dell, Cisco, Fujitsu, Huawei, and Lenovo have also been added to a long list of vendor partnerships. This gives Australian solution providers and systems integrators a simple way to transform, for instance, Dell or Cisco infrastructure by pairing it with DataCore software and backend storage to form comprehensive, flexible, software-defined platforms that serve as the cornerstone of the next-generation, software-defined data center.

Distributed in Australia by Avnet and Westcon, DataCore solutions are available and deployed via accredited systems integration partners.
